The 7.18 Moeka Anime Convention D1 shoot of my custom White formal wear cosplay Robin cosplay wrapped up smoothly. The biggest surprise this time was the set of six-winged ear feathers prepared in advance: in the crowded venue, one accidental bump broke the accessory. Out of necessity, I had to make an emergency on-site fix, turning it into the two-winged version seen in the photos. Although losing the grand wings was a slight pity, the two-winged look actually felt closer to the light, ethereal aesthetic of this custom design.

For makeup, to match the cool and ethereal vibe, I chose highly pigmented green colored contacts paired with tiny rhinestones under the eyes and slightly heavier blush to counter the washed-out camera effect. Wearing this white lace tube top and double-layered pearl necklace wasn't as effortless as it looked—plus, the lace choker around my neck felt tight, so I barely dared to look down and eat during the day for fear of leaving red marks.
